Seminar paper from the year 2008 in the subject Psychology - Cognition, grade: 2,0, University of Cologne, language: English, comment: Psychology, Behavior and Neurosciences, abstract: What kind of inner progress urges the tax evader to pay his tax: Is it the sovereign thought about the consequences, the late conviction that paying taxes is honest or is it more than thinking and feeling - perhaps it is an unavoidable reaction on that external tax collecting factor, determined by the tax payer's genes? This research paper is a view inside the taxpaying individual itself: In case of taxation an internal motivation to cooperate exists and it is influenced by the level of neurotransmitters.
